Giant’s Trail Race Returns This Friday in Belfast

Giant’s Trail Race Returns This Friday in Belfast

Published on: 21 Jul 2025

Author: Phil Knox

Categories: Mountain & Trail Road Running Events

If your idea of a good Friday night involves mud, hills, and Neolithic monuments, then the Giant’s Trail Race might just be your kind of craic.

Hosted by Dub Runners and taking place on Friday 25th July at 7pm, this 6-mile trail event starts and finishes at Queen’s University’s playing fields on Upper Malone Road. It’s a properly scenic spin through Lagan Valley Regional Park, with a route that combines forest trails, riverside towpaths, rolling pastures, and a healthy bit of up-and-down for the legs.

The Route: Woodlands, Sculptures, and Giant’s Rings

This isn’t just a jog around the park, runners will climb through the woods of Minnowburn, cruise along the River Lagan, pass quirky sculptures and natural art installations, and loop through the ancient surroundings of the Giant’s Ring, a Neolithic monument that adds a nice dash of history to your lactic acid.

From there it’s on through Edenderry village, across Gilchrist Bridge, and along Shaw’s Bridge to the finish line, where your legs will thank you and your lungs will question your life choices.

The elevation profile? Let’s say it’s “undulating” in that charming, Belfast-trail-race kind of way, nothing technical, but enough to remind you it’s not your local parkrun.

There are only a few remaining entries, so best get signed up now to avoid disappointment. While this one doesn’t require you to be an ultra trail goat, it’s still a proper off-road test. Expect a mix of gravel paths, grass, towpath and trail. Trail shoes are recommended but not essential, and if you’ve done a bit of parkrun or cross country, you’ll be grand.
